Synopsis

In "Frights: Night of the Living Puppet," ten-year-old Wayne Johnson and his younger sister, Scarlett, stumble upon an old puppet named Woody during a walk in the woods. What begins as a playful discovery quickly turns into a chilling adventure as Woody reveals a sinister, living side. As strange and frightening events unfold, Wayne, Scarlett, and their friend Chad must confront the unsettling truth that Woody is not just an ordinary puppet. Despite their efforts to rid themselves of Woody, the puppet's mysterious powers keep him returning, causing chaos and fear. With school holidays turning into a nightmare, the siblings are determined to uncover the secret behind Woody's life-like behavior and put an end to his haunting presence once and for all. Will they succeed, or will Woody's sinister laughter echo forever in their lives?
